#624cb7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#624cb7 is composed of 38.4% red, 29.8%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.4%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 252.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 50.8%. #624cb7 color hex could be obtained by blending #c498ff with #00006f.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#624cb7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f5f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#624cb7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7c87 is the less saturated color, while #3a08fb is the most saturated one.
